English: no, not, none
|
Bundjalung:
yagam, yagambeh
|
Part of Speech: interjection, adverb

Comment: General sentence negator, frequently has emphatic suffix (yagambeh); yagambehwen- (irregular) to disappear Wa; also an introducer; can take -beh suffix (mild intensifier), or -bu 'yet'; yagam baray 'not very' Gd; possibly yugam in Wa:Tabulm:Hargrv.

Example:
Bundjalung : Yagambeh ngadju ganngahla gumbaynggirnah nguyay (from W)
English: 'I don't understand Gumbaynggir'
|
Example:
Bundjalung : yagambu (from G)
English: 'not yet'
